That South Cobb clay is beautiful for building but terrible for grass roots. Natural turf in Mableton struggles because water either pools on top or drains away too fast, leaving your grass stressed. Artificial turf actually thrives in these conditions because it doesn't depend on soil quality or drainage the same way. Your patio size matters too—most Mableton condos have 200 to 500 square feet of usable space, which is perfect for turf installation. We prep the base properly to account for Cobb County's soil composition, which means better longevity and no settling issues down the road. Sun exposure varies depending on whether you're in Heritage Park or deeper into the Mableton neighborhoods. Some patios get full afternoon sun (which real grass loves but makes people miserable in summer), while others are mostly shaded. Artificial turf handles both without stress. Check your HOA rules before you start—most allow turf on patios, but some have specific color or pile-height requirements. We'll help you navigate that. Georgia's humidity means you'll want quality infill that resists mold and odor, especially on a patio where airflow can be limited.
Most Mableton condo associations allow artificial turf on patios, but some have restrictions on blade height or color. We recommend checking your CC&Rs first. If your HOA requires approval, we can provide samples and specifications to submit. Heritage Park and other Mableton neighborhoods typically welcome turf because it solves their biggest headache—unmaintained natural grass that looks worse every season. We've gotten approval for dozens of installs in this area.
Our turf systems include drainage layers and quality infill designed for Georgia's climate. The South Cobb clay underneath actually works in your favor because we install proper sub-base prep. Water drains through the turf and infill layer, preventing pooling that would kill natural grass. Mableton's humidity won't cause mold if you choose the right infill and maintain basic rinse-offs. We recommend a quick hose-down a few times per year.
A standard patio installation in Mableton takes 2 to 4 days depending on size and base prep. Most patios in the Heritage Park area and surrounding neighborhoods are 200 to 500 square feet, so you're usually looking at a quick turnaround.
